我日常喜歡用notebook,課程的課件通常分門別類分紅多個notebook進行製做,可是最近 2019年7月13-18日(杭州)Stata & Python 實證計量與爬蟲分析暑期工做坊 快要臨近,須要提早將課件印製出來。git
打印課件爲了防止出錯,每一個講師儘可能只提供一個pdf文件,而個人課件其實是十幾個notebook文件,須要合併爲一個notebook才能在瀏覽器輸出爲一個pdf文件,方便打印,但怎麼合併呢?github
好在有google,通過檢索發現瀏覽器
github庫ide
https
:
//github.com/jbn/nbmerge
google
安裝
!
pip3 install nbmerge
命令行
用法
打開命令行,切換到待操做的notebook所在的文件夾。
code
nbmerge file_1 . ipynb file_2 . ipynb file_3 . ipynb > merged . ipynb
例如本教程中咱們新建了兩個ipynb文件,分別爲01.ipynb和02.ipynbblog